The ULTIMATE series CNC press brake is a modern machine designed for bending sheet metal at any angle. Its high-performance design ensures precise bending even during extended operation. The press comes as standard with four axes: X, Y1, Y2, and R, as well as automatic deflection compensation. CNC control DELEM 53TX, pressing force from 60 to 400 tonnes, and bending length from 1,300 to 6,100 mm.

Laser operator hand protection: DSP
The system works only during the rapid approach of the beam.
It enables the lowest points above the material for switching the approach speed to working speed.
It does not require special pedal pressing sequences.
It allows quick tool changes (automatic positioning of the transmitter and receiver after changing the tool to a type of different length)
It does not require stopping in box mode
It does not increase cycle time when bending in box mode compared to other safeguards
It allows bending of material with an uneven surface (e.g. corrugated, uneven, dirty sheet metal), thanks to changing to slow speed at any point of the rapid movement.

Y1, Y2 axes - these are the axes responsible for the operation of the bending beam. Y1 is the left side and Y2 is the right side. Control of the entire bending process is handled by the CNC system by means of a hydraulic system integrated with the measuring system, which consists of measuring scales located on the left and right sides of the machine. CNC-controlled press brakes are synchronous machines, meaning they have independent control of the left and right cylinders, allowing free correction of parallelism and correction of the bending angle independently on both Y1 and Y2 sides.
X - this is the axis responsible for the movement of the backgauge in the front-rear plane. It is responsible for maintaining the dimension of the bent sides of the workpiece. It is driven by a stepper motor or servo drive, while the drive transmission mechanism consists of ball screws. The encoder is responsible for determining the position and accuracy of the gauge. CNC controls can automatically calculate the X position in order to obtain the appropriate bending dimension, taking into account thickness, material type, the tools used, bending angle, and whether the dimension on the drawing is external or internal.
R - this is also a machine gauge axis, responsible for movement in the up-down plane. It is usually driven by a transmission controlled by a servo drive. The encoder is also responsible for position and accuracy. The zero point for the R axis is the height of the die currently installed on the press table. In modern CNC controls, the gauge fingers have several reference planes or sheet support positions; after selecting the gauge position in the control, the machine automatically corrects the R height and the X position of the gauge.

The press brake body is built from side walls and a table. The force on the table is applied by the bending beam moving in the body guides. Both the table and the beam are supported at two points. When very large forces act on the bent sheet metal, the table deflects. This causes a problem in achieving the set angle in the centre of the table. To obtain the same angle along the entire length of the bent sheet, it is necessary to equip the machine with a table compensation system. The most commonly used system is a mechanical system. This is the so-called opposing wave system. The underside of the press table is milled so that it can accommodate two strips with an opposing wave. The lower strip is fixed, while movement is carried out through the upper strip manually using a crank with a built-in scale or automatically through a transmission driven by a servo drive. This system ideally compensates for table deformations occurring during the sheet bending process, thereby ensuring high accuracy in maintaining the set angle value.
